IP geolocation is the method of determining a device's location by using its Internet Protocol address (IP). IP addresses are unique for each device and can be assigned to specific geographical areas. The information is stored in databases which are regularly updated. The databases are made up of a variety sources such as regional IP address registries, user-submitted addresses on websites and network routes.

Two-factor authentication (2FA)

Two-factor authentication (2FA) is an additional security feature that shields your account from hackers by requiring a second factor to verify. Although it's not a guarantee of complete security, it can make unauthorized access more difficult. It also helps users avoid the dreadful feeling of security that can result when people use the same password on multiple accounts, thereby reducing their chances of being a victim of a data breach.

Even if someone knows your username and your password however, they will not be able to log in to your account using 2FA since the second requirement is for authorization. It is also more secure than basic verification, which is based solely on the password users know.

Hardware tokens and mobile phones are two of the most commonly used 2FA methods. The simplest and most efficient method is push notification, that sends a verification number to the phone of the user, which allows them to verify their identity with a click or tap. This method is only feasible with an internet connection that is reliable.

Biometrics, FIDO and FIDO Alliance are other 2FA options. These methods provide greater security over traditional passwords, but require users to purchase the appropriate equipment or wearables. These devices are susceptible to being stolen or lost and increase the chance of unauthorised access.

Although the concept of a slot audit may seem simple, it can be a challenge to be carried out effectively. This is due to a high level of cooperation among various casino departments, including slot operation team employees in cages, slot operators, and soft count teams. If these departments are not working together, it could be easy for players to alter the outcome of a game.

To conduct a slot audit, a casino needs two independent data sources. Each part of the win equation needs to be taken into account. For instance, for the bills that are inserted, the auditor should have both game meters and physical counts. Comparing these sources of data will reveal bonus round slots with different numbers. These can be analyzed and data adjusted accordingly.

Tools for responsible gaming

Responsible gaming tools are crucial to ensure that casinos remain enjoyable and safe for players. These tools help players manage their gambling habits and fight the addiction of gambling. These tools include deposit limits, timeout sessions and cooling off times and wagering limits real-time checks, self-exclusion and wagering limits. Once players log into their accounts, they can access these tools.

The tools are different from one online casino to another, but all regulated US casinos provide them in some form. This is an essential part of their commitment to responsible gambling. It also helps players avoid identity theft, money laundering, and gambling underage. These tools encourage ethical advertising and ensure that ads do not target minors.

Many sites use verification services in addition to the tools listed above to confirm that users are older than 21. These services can be offered by a third-party, or by the software of the site. These services are usually free and help to prevent underage gambling.
